With Orium, e-logistics and e-commerce set the tone for commerce of the future
E-logistician for 9 years, currently operating in 7 European countries including France and soon in the US, Orium has been able to win the trust of both large accounts and e-commerce specialists such as Nespresso, Smartbox, Dukan, Wanimo and also Marie-Claire. Orium is well known for the agility and reliability with which it is able to manage the complete e-commerce value chain.
This success has its origins in Orium’s approach with an early optimisation of automation and informatics. Today production is concentrated around a leading WMS ( Reflex, Hardis) and a dedicated ERP system which is flexible and evolutionary ( Logorium). Created internally, the ERP system has been designed to be in phase with the level of service requirements of the digital economy.
Orium has also created an international network to support the deployment of its clients outside France. It is therefore capable to steer their stocks and logistics “overseas” as well as locally in Europe.

Innovation, driving force of competitiveness, will be the central theme in 2011 behind all aspects of the event synchronising the contents from the plenary conferences and the solutions presented by the exhibitors.
As a result, for 2011 SITL has a new name.
In effect, Real Time gives way to Logistics Solutions, better adapted to the evolution of a sector which must now think in terms of end-to-end global supply chains.
To support this new identity, SITL takes on a different structure.
The former three sectors have been replaced by four simplified, clear and complementary activity centres: Transport- Storage, Warehousing and related Equipment- Logistics platforms- Technologies and Information systems to which a fifth zone has been added which is dedicated to shipment and warehouse security.
Innovation, driving force of logistics competitiveness
With a new name, new visual identity, redefined categories of skills and direct access to the RFID and Eco Transport & Logistics exhibitions, SITL Logistics Solutions 2011 takes its place with the badge of innovation.
SITL Logistics Solutions is the new brand name for the event organised by Reed Expositions at the Parc des Expositions de Paris – Porte de Versailles and which alternates with SITL Europe. New visual identity, new logo, these changes are in line with the evolution of the show as it adapts to the needs of the market.
As Laurent Noel, event director, explains “The previous name for the show- SITL Real Time- did not reflect the global offer available which is dedicated to supply chain managers, logisticians and buyers of Transport-Logistics solutions. We needed to better respond to their requirements in terms of information systems, modes of transport, logistics supplies, warehouse location and design together with warehouse equipment and handling including consultancy. With SITL Logistics Solutions the message becomes much clearer.”

SITL EUROPE 2010 EXHIBITION REPORT
All those involved across the supply chain together with their suppliers attended the 2010 event in large numbers making the 27th edition of the exhibition a success in spite of the transport strikes on the first day. An important increase in both exhibitor and visitor numbers in a year marked by the dynamism of a particularly rich events programme.
SITL 2010 presented many new features : the international Transport and Logistics forum hosted over 40 conferences with a day dedicated entirely to rail freight, Russia was the guest country, the 10th logistics innovation awards took place and the RFID exhibition was held at the same time- all in the space of 4 days.
